Skills Development
In the ever-changing world, possessing certain skills will enable a more successful transition into the many occupations you will have throughout your lifetime.

a) Essential Skills
Professionals and employers define essential skills as those needed for everyday life and work. These skills provide the foundation for learning all other skills and enable people to evolve with their jobs and adapt to change.
The nine essential skills are as follows:
-
Reading Text
-
Writing
-
Continuous Learning
-
Document Use
-
Oral Communication
-
Thinking Skills
-
Numeracy
-
Working With Others
-
Computer Use
b) Employability Skills
Employability skills are the basic skills that are required to perform effectively in the workplace. They consist of fundamental skills, teamwork skills and personal management skills.
A more detailed breakdown of these skills is as follows:
Fundamental Skills
- Communicate
- Manage Information
- Use Numbers
- Think & Solve Problems
Teamwork Skills
- Work With Others
- Participate in Projects and Task
Personal Management Skills
- DemonstratePositive Attitudes and Behaviors
- Be Responsible
- Be Adaptable
- Learn Continuously
- Work Safely
